The lumbar spine, or lower back, is another frequent source of exercise-bike-related pain. The problem can also be caused by the positioning of your seat—typically too high. One way to know if this is the case is if your hips drop to either side as you pedal. "When you push down with your right leg and your right hip ... blood clots in calf muscle
